Valerie, We at Bellingham Cohousing have an online sign-up for meals.  We
generally charge $5 per adult and less or none for children. We tally the
charges for the month for each household and then bill the total meals on
their dues statements. The meals team has 2 debit cards that they share
with other cooks.  The debit cards are tied to a separate bank account
where we maintain a low balance so that if the cards ever got away from us,
our main checking account would not be threatened.
